Lyrics

Verse 1
He's just a kid, he doesn't know better
Just wants the candy behind the door
He isn't thinkin' 'bout regret or the mess he'll make
Good thing his mamma's there to save the day and prevent a big mistake

Verse 2
They put their daughter on a bus and saw the driver shut the door
She's headed for college and they can't afford it
But right now they're not thinkin' how to repay
They only hope that on her own she'll remember to say:

Chorus
Lead me not into the wrong door
I'm just a creature who's weak, and some doors hold things too good to ignore
Stay my hand before I open the wrong door

Verse 3
A man back at that bus stop, with just his thoughts, lookin' stranded, thinkin': "How did I get so far in life and end up empty handed? Why did I choose the things I chose and do the things I did?
If I knew then what I know now, I would have said":

Chorus
Lead me not into the wrong door
I'm just a creature who's weak, and some doors hold things too good to ignore
Stay my hand before I open the wrong door
